Q: What is a 6-needle home embroidery machine?

A: A 6-needle embroidery machine handles six thread colors simultaneously for multi-color designs. It automates complex embroidery with minimal manual thread changes. This increases efficiency for home-based embroidery projects.

Q: Why choose a 6-needle machine over fewer needles?

A: Six needles enable complex multi-color designs without frequent thread changes. This dramatically reduces production time for detailed embroidery. Higher needle counts also improve color registration accuracy for professional results.
